Patterns in nature are visible regularities of form found in the natural world. These patterns recur in different contexts and can sometimes be modelled mathematically.Natural patterns include symmetries trees spirals meanders waves foams tessellations cracks and stripes. Early Greek philosophers studied pattern with Plato Pythagoras and Empedocles attempting to explain order in nature.
Broadening top (a.k.a. a megaphone pattern ) is technical analysis chart pattern describing trends of stocks commodities currencies and other assets. Broadening Top formation appears much more frequently at tops than at bottoms. Its formation usually has bearish implications.. It is a common saying that smart money is out of market in such formation and market is out of control.

Distichous phyllotaxis also called “two-ranked leaf arrangement” is a special case of either opposite or alternate leaf arrangement where the leaves on a stem are arranged in two vertical columns on opposite sides of the stem.
